Premium, Beige ESD Matting 1.0x10m Rolls, now only £250.00! The KSMLF1MBEI matting is made with a durable, synthetic rubber material. It is comprised of two layers: a static-dissipative surface and a conductive backing, giving a typical resistance to ground of 106-108 ohms. The static-dissipative surface has excellent resistance to abrasion, heat and solder splash. The black, conductive backing provides a superior and consistent ground path to Earth. The material doesn’t melt if in contact with hot metal parts or soldering debris; cheaper PVC based rubber mats are not solder proof.

The KSMLF1MBEI matting has textured, scratch-resistant surface, protecting the surface of static sensitive components during production. The bench matting can be loose-laid at a workstation without the need for any adhesives. Beige ESD Matting 1.0x10m Rolls are fully RoHS and REACH compliant and conform to requirements of EN61340-5-1, BS IEC 61340-5-1, US ESD Associations ANSI S4.1 and S20.20 guidelines, which is the recognised international standards for EPAs.

Cleaning Care

To safely clean your ESD mat, we recommend using a mild, multi-purpose neutral cleaner that doesn’t contain any alkali, ammonia or chemicals on RoHS and REACH SvHC. You should also opt for a cleaner that leaves no streaks or film. Generally, any ESD-safe mat cleaner should be safe to use on workstations, table tops and anti-static mats, including rubber and vinyl.
